A note on Hamiltonian cycles in generalized Halin graphs

Magdalena Bojarska

Discussiones Mathematicae Graph Theory (2010)

  • Volume: 30, Issue: 4, page 701-704
  • ISSN: 2083-5892

Abstract

top
We show that every 2-connected (2)-Halin graph is Hamiltonian.
